    Here's the thing...once you get a couple of add-ons, MP-10 was basically THE perfect standard for "Masterpiece".
    He had:
    -replay value (trailer, roller, mini figs, etc)
    -no argument of "cartoon versus toy accuracy"
    -no QC issues to speak of

    My MP-10 has (don't remember which companies did all these):
    -LED eyes/head
    -LED matrix
    -hose/gas nozzle kit for roller
    -bigger gun (that doesn't fold weak-saucely in half and look cheap as hell)
    -arm panel mods / chrome smokestacks
    -fully articulated KFC hands

    There are only TWO changes I would still make (or buy add-ons to upgrade):
    -LED-enabled ion rifle
    -hinged skirts that allow his hips to rotate UP fully (for sitting positions)

    Due to all of the weird expectations and offerings that have evolved over the years with TT and 3P toys, one of my personal and weird standards for "MP" has become "can this bot assume a proper seated position?"...check your detolfs, you'd be surprised at how many of your "high-end" toys cannot perform this simple, basic function (of which MP-10 is guilty, due to how his truck diaper has no hinges built into it).

    If MP-10 could fully SIT (and maybe cross one ankle over the other leg...the TRUE test) he would be truly PERFECT...but am I going to spring for V. 3?

    No.

    I'm not personally after any more Masterpiece figures, but I see enough of my friends and fellow collectors excited for this, so good for them! MP-10 is still a delightful and relevant figure, sure. However when you compare its posability and level of engineering with Megatron MP-36 and Sunstreaker, it's not quite at the same level while still a brilliant figure in and of itself. If the aim of MP Convoy V3 is to stand comparably with the level of engineering, articulation and heavier toon-styling of MP-36, then I don't think it signals a scale reboot. It could open the doors for a new MP Starscream and seeker series, maybe the odd re-imagined MP car with up to date engineering and articulation like Sunny, but i think it would be good for a lot of MP collectors to have a Prime worthy of the Megatron we just got.
